20120082750 | AIR SIDE PIVOT CASTING FOR MOLD CLAMPING LINKAGE SYSTEM - A pivot casting component used in an apparatus for extrusion blow molding polyethylene teraphthalate (“PET”) is disclosed. The pivot casting is designed to provide increased strength and increased reliability over prior components with the blow mold clamping linkage system. Prior art pivot elements were designed and fabricated from separate elements such that weak points, and stress concentration points were created. Such weak points resulted in the pivot element being a weak component in the blow mold clamping linkage system. The inventive pivot casting is cast as a single component from higher strength materials, with an improved geometry to increase component strength, durability and overall system reliability. In a preferred embodiment, the air side pivot casting is formed from 80-55-06 ductile iron resulting in a 40% increase in tensile strength over prior pivot components. | 2012-04-05 |

20120082772 | Method For Sterilization Of Food - The present invention provides a food sterilization method by which the effective sterilization of the spore-forming bacteria having high heat resistance and high pressure resistance is possible without impairing the taste, flavor, and texture of food. A method for sterilization of food comprising: high-pressure treatment step in which one or more amino acids selected from the group consisting of cysteine, alanine, methionine, phenylalanine, serine, leucine, and glycine is added to a sterilization target food, and then the sterilization target food including the amino acid is treated at 50 to 600 MPa for 1 to 120 minutes; and low-temperature heating step in which the sterilization target food is heated at 60 to 100° C. for 5 minutes or more after the high-pressure treatment step. | 2012-04-05 |

20120082801 | METHOD OF LASER TREATING Ti-6AI-4V TO FORM SURFACE COMPOUNDS - The method of laser treating Ti-6Al-4V to form surface compounds is a method of forming barrier layers on surfaces of Ti-6Al-4V workpieces. The Ti-6Al-4V workpiece is first cleaned and then a water-soluble phenolic resin is applied to at least one surface of the Ti-6Al-4V workpiece. The Ti-6Al-4V workpiece and the layer(s) of water soluble phenolic resin are then heated to carbonize the phenolic resin, thus forming a carbon film on the at least one surface. TiC particles are then inserted into the carbon film. Following the insertion of the TiC particles, a laser beam is scanned over the at least one surface of the Ti-6Al-4V workpiece. A stream of nitrogen gas is sprayed on the surface of the Ti-6Al-4V workpiece coaxially and simultaneously with the laser beam at a relatively high pressure, thus forming a barrier layer of TiC | 2012-04-05 |
20120082802 | POWER LOADING SUBSTRATES TO REDUCE PARTICLE CONTAMINATION - A method for preventing particle contamination within a processing chamber is disclosed. Preheating the substrate within the processing chamber may cause a thermophoresis effect so that particles within the chamber that are not adhered to a surface may not come to rest on the substrate. One method to increase the substrate temperature is to plasma load the substrate. Plasma loading comprises providing an inert gas plasma to the substrate to heat the substrate. Another method to increase the substrate temperature is high pressure loading the substrate. High pressure loading comprises heating the substrate while increasing the chamber pressure to between about 1 Torr and about 10 Torr. By rapidly increasing the substrate temperature within the processing chamber prior to substrate processing, particle contamination is less likely to occur. | 2012-04-05 |
